AUT University operates three campuses in Auckland Central (City Campus) and the suburbs of Northcote (North Campus) and Manukau (South Campus). Campuses of this university boast excellent learning spaces, administrative offices, and recreational and residence halls.
AUT provides an on-campus housing facility to students in the apartment- and townhouse-style catered and self-catered rooms. Each campus is close to shopping, entertainment, and recreational centres. AUT operates several buses to enable easy mobility across the campuses.

The following candidates are eligible to appear in JAC Chandigarh counselling round 2:
- Type–I: Registered candidates who were not allotted a seat in the First round. These candidates may visit the website and modify their earlier choices (OPTIONAL) else choices submitted in the First Round shall continue to be considered in this round.
